Responsibilities:

  • Conduct Occupational Therapy In-Home Assessments to assess Attendant Care Needs (Form 1) and assistive devices
  • Provide treatment with Implementation of functional and cognitive strategies and techniques as appropriate
  • Demonstrate Diversity, Equity and Inclusion principles with all clients and family members
  • Document accident benefits initial and progress reports
  • Supervise rehab support worker with carry through of Occupational Therapy goals
  • Provide education to clients/family; follow-up with progress with respect to SMART goals
  • Work collaboratively with an interdisciplinary team and participate in meetings
  • Facilitate rehabilitation of client with cognitive, emotional or physical impairments
  • Monitor and assess client rehabilitative programs
  • Convey treatment results and client progress to an interdisciplinary team
  • Organize and update client records

Qualifications:

  • Valid Occupational Therapy Insurance from respective association (i.e. CAOT, OSOT)
  • Valid Ontario Driver's License
  • Previous experience in the auto insurance sector is an asset
  • Passion to help and motivate others
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
